WebDec 10, 2024 · Physical anxiety symptom 7: Headaches. Anxiety and panic attacks commonly cause tension headaches due to a build-up of stress. They can feel dull or sharp and occur in different areas in the head. Headaches can also be a result of tiredness due to lack of sleep caused by anxiety.
